SUPERVISORY CONTRACT SPECIALIST
US Department of War
Job Title
The role involves planning work to be accomplished by subordinates to meet program goals, objectives, and broad command priorities. It includes setting and adjusting short-term priorities and preparing schedules for completion of work. The position also requires developing performance standards and evaluating the work performance of subordinates. Additionally, it involves administering long-term, complex contracts for facilities construction, design, and services affecting major agency programs. The duties further include preparing, reviewing, and approving delivery/task order and modification award documentation. Cost and price analysis and ensuring compliance with cost accounting standards are also part of the responsibilities. Periodic meetings with team members are necessary to set policies/procedures for consistent execution of contract actions and to solicit problems experienced by the team in the procurement processes. Pre-award functions for procurements involving complex contracts for facilities construction, design, and services of significant importance to the agency are required. Finally, the role includes serving as a Contracting Officer.
